Product reviews:
American Bass USA XFL 1244 2000W Max american bass subs any good
american bass subs any good
Owen
2026-02-14 iphone 11 Pro
American Bass HD 12 D1 12 inch 4000W american bass subs any good
american bass subs any good
Lyndon
2026-02-16 iphone X
Car Audio, Subwoofers \u0026 Amplifiers american bass subs any good
american bass subs any good